Registered Nurse Jobs in San Diego: Frequently Asked Questions
How do I get a registered nurse job in San Diego?
The strongest hiring in San Diego comes from its large hospital networks, military-affiliated medical centers, and the growing cluster of outpatient and specialty clinics in Mission Valley and Kearny Mesa. Candidates with experience in med-surg, ICU, or emergency departments move fastest in this market. Prioritizing employers with high patient volumes and applying directly to posted openings gives you the clearest path to an offer.

Are there remote registered nurse jobs in San Diego?
Yes, though remote work is limited for most registered nurse roles given the hands-on nature of direct patient care. About 4% of registered nurse openings tied to San Diego are remote or hybrid as of July 2026, with those opportunities concentrated in utilization review, case management, and telephonic triage positions.
How can I get a registered nurse job in San Diego with little or no experience?
The most realistic entry path in San Diego is a new graduate residency program at one of the city's large hospital systems, which are structured to bring RNs from licensure to independent practice. Community hospitals in areas like Chula Vista and El Cajon also hire new grads more readily than flagship academic centers. Strong clinical rotation performance and a CEN or ACLS certification early on helps candidates stand out locally.
